I think her connection to Kitty stems from her maternal bond with Kate Pryde of her time. Kate was the one who cared for Rachel both as a child and then once she was sent to the concentration camp post being a hound. Once she came to this timeline she was nearly the same age as Kitty (who vaguely remembered her) and latched on as a familiar face. Same with Storm, except our Storm was a little cold in comparison to the Ororoe she new.
